Output 63abf94219af72013a26ae18ff66b766d6ff047e6fcc9b55921020a1db5deb6e:2

value
123230622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1abb781580450bd959c4c42fed6a056953cfd9a OP_EQUAL
address
MQ6bYUfc7jxjnJxsXDm1fQ4JArcZiNAdNX
transaction
63abf94219af72013a26ae18ff66b766d6ff047e6fcc9b55921020a1db5deb6e
spent
true